728x90
반응형
웹 개발자라면 UI 컴포넌트 라이브러리의 중요성을 잘 알고 계실 것입니다. UI 컴포넌트는 버튼, 드롭다운 메뉴, 모달, 카드 등 웹사이트와 웹 애플리케이션에서 사용되는 기본적인 UI 요소들을 제공합니다. 컴포넌트를 사용하면 개발 시간을 단축하고 코드 작성량을 줄이며, 일관된 디자인을 유지할 수 있습니다.
Svelte는 최근 인기를 얻고 있는 프론트엔드 자바스크립트 프레임워크입니다. Svelte는 간결하고 명확한 문법으로 배우기 쉽고, 빠른 성능과 작은 코드 크기를 제공합니다.
Flowbite Svelte는 Svelte를 위한 공식 UI 컴포넌트 라이브러리입니다. Tailwind CSS와 Flowbite를 기반으로 구축된 Flowbite Svelte는 다음과 같은 장점을 제공합니다.
- 빠르고 쉬운 개발: Flowbite Svelte는 미리 만들어진 UI 컴포넌트를 제공하여 개발 시간을 단축하고 코드 작성량을 줄여줍니다.
- 반응형 디자인: 모든 컴포넌트는 기본적으로 반응형이며, 다양한 화면 크기에 맞게 자동으로 조정됩니다.
- 손쉬운 사용: Svelte의 간결하고 명확한 문법을 사용하여 컴포넌트를 쉽게 사용하고 커스터마이징할 수 있습니다.
- Tailwind CSS와의 완벽한 통합: Tailwind CSS의 유틸리티 클래스를 사용하여 컴포넌트의 모양과 느낌을 손쉽게 조정할 수 있습니다.
- 다양한 컴포넌트: 버튼, 드롭다운 메뉴, 모달, 네비게이션 메뉴, 카드, 양식 등 다양한 UI 컴포넌트를 제공합니다.
Flowbite Svelte 사용 방법
1. 설치:
npm install flowbite-svelte
2. 사용:
import { Button } from 'flowbite-svelte';
<Button>버튼</Button>
3. 문서 및 예제:
Flowbite Svelte는 공식 문서와 다양한 예제를 제공합니다.
- 문서: https://flowbite-svelte.com/docs/pages/introduction
- 예제: https://github.com/themesberg/flowbite-svelte
Flowbite Svelte의 장점
- 개발 속도 향상: 미리 만들어진 컴포넌트를 사용하여 개발 시간을 단축하고 코드 작성량을 줄일 수 있습니다.
- 일관된 디자인: 모든 컴포넌트는 Tailwind CSS 디자인 시스템을 기반으로 하여 일관된 디자인을 제공합니다.
- 손쉬운 유지 관리: 컴포넌트는 재사용 가능하고 유지 관리하기 쉽습니다.
- 커뮤니티 지원: 활발한 커뮤니티가 지원하여 도움을 받을 수 있습니다.
Flowbite Svelte 활용 사례
- 웹사이트: Flowbite Svelte를 사용하여 빠르고 쉽게 아름다운 웹사이트를 만들 수 있습니다.
- 웹 애플리케이션: Flowbite Svelte를 사용하여 반응형 웹 애플리케이션을 만들 수 있습니다.
- UI 디자인 프로토타입: Flowbite Svelte를 사용하여 빠르고 쉽게 UI 디자인 프로토타입을 만들 수 있습니다.
결론
Flowbite Svelte는 Svelte 개발자를 위한 강력하고 유용한 UI 컴포넌트 라이브러리입니다. Flowbite Svelte를 사용하면 개발 속도를 높이고, 일관된 디자인을 제공하며, 유지 관리가 쉽습니다.
728x90
반응형
'프로그래밍' 카테고리의 다른 글
Flowbite Svelte #5 - Flowbite Svelte 사용 예제 (0) | 2024.07.08 |
---|---|
Flowbite Svelte #5 - Flowbite Svelte를 사용하는 이유 (0) | 2024.07.08 |
Flowbite Svelte #3 - 튜토리얼 (0) | 2024.07.01 |
Flowbite Svelte #2 - 시작 (0) | 2024.06.28 |
npm vs. pnpm (0) | 2024.06.27 |